Description

Silverfort is on a mission to bring identity security everywhere – to every human, machine, and AI agent, both on-prem and in the cloud. Our unique technology secures identities & access at runtime, in ways that weren’t possible before. With the broadest identity security platform in the market, trusted by more than 1,000 customers including many Fortune 100 companies, Silverfort is uniquely positioned to lead the fast-growing identity security category.

Joining Silverfort means becoming part of a fast-moving team with a culture of innovation and collaboration, that goes above and beyond to help our customers and each other, on a journey to reshape the future of identity security.

As a Senior Sales Engineer in an overlay capacity, you will be the primary technical expert for AI agent security and cloud identity engagements across North America. Working alongside existing account teams, you will be engaged wherever AI and cloud identity complexity requires dedicated technical depth — leading discovery, designing POC frameworks, and driving strategic wins to close. In your first year, success looks like a defined AI agent security playbook, measurable wins in cloud identity accounts, and trusted partnerships with the account teams you support.

Responsibilities
  • Serve as the deep technical expert on AI agent security and cloud identity across North American account teams
  • Lead technical scoping, POC design, and architecture workshops for accounts with complex cloud and AI environments
  • Design and execute POC environments for securing AI agent identities, non-human service accounts, cloud workload identities, and machine-to-machine authentication across AWS, Azure, and GCP
  • Build repeatable delivery assets — technical guides, demo environments, and battle cards — that account teams can activate on AI and cloud identity opportunities
  • Partner cross-functionally with AEs, CSMs, and the Silverfort product team to drive AI and cloud identity wins to close
  • Bridge Silverfort's identity platform and the emerging AI and cloud identity threat landscape for customers
Requirements
  • 5+ years of experience in a pre-sales, sales engineering, or technical security role
  • Deep knowledge of cloud identity platforms (Azure AD / Entra ID, AWS IAM, GCP, Okta)
  • Hands-on experience securing AI agent identities, non-human service accounts, API keys, or automation pipelines in production cloud environments
  • Experience working in an overlay or specialist SE capacity, or demonstrated ability to operate without direct account ownership
  • Strong understanding of how AI tooling (Copilot, Claude, Cursor, etc.) is expanding the attack surface
  • Ability to manage multiple concurrent engagements across different account teams
  • Security certifications (CISSP, CCSP, Microsoft SC-300, CyberArk Defender, Okta Professional)
  • Experience working with MSSP, VAR, or channel partners in a pre-sales capacity
  • Background in regulated industries (financial services, healthcare, critical infrastructure)

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
